Welcome to the Green School blog!!!

This year The Green School Committee is hoping to renew its energy flag.

The committee has been working hard to achieve this and to raise energy awareness in the school. The committee has organised lots of activities to promote awareness this year.

So Follow the Green School Code:

"GREEN: Get Really Energy Efficient Now!!!!!"





  1. Turn off lights,


  2. Open blinds,


  3. Turn down heat when not needed,


  4. Dont leave computers or electrical appliances on stand-by,


  5. Walk or Cycle to school: Avoid Traffic Chaos.

The school Gardeners:

Transition year Students have created beautiful hanging baskets and flower pots at the entrance to the school.



A small garden in the centre of the school has been developed containing flowers, herbs and plants.



We are hoping to expand this project in september by creating an organic garden.



Sensor Lights



The committee is also responsible foe a project to change bathroom and changing room lights to sensor lights. We are hoping to complete this project by September 2009.
